Q:   What is programme specific eligibility criteria in CUET?
A:

For admission to the desirous University/Institution, the candidates must appear in CUET 2026 in the Languages and Domain Specific subjects as per the Program-Specific Eligibility for which s (he) is desirous to take admission. For instance, if a candidate wishes to apply for B.Com (Hons.) programe in Delhi University he/she will be required to make the subject combination as :

Combination I: Any one Language from List A +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two subjects out of which at least one should be from List B1
OR
Combination II: Any one Language from List A + Accountancy/Book Keeping + Any two subjects out of which at least one should be from List B1

Candidates are advised to check CUET programme-specific eligibility criteria before filling the application form, failing which they will not qualify for further admission process.

DU CUET Subject Combination

Candidates willing to take admission to the University of Delhi through CUET scores must check the DU CUET combination for its 73 UG course eligibility:

DU CUET Subject Combination: Science Courses

Check the list of 32 UG Science courses by University of Delhi through CUET scores

Degree DU CUET Courses Offered DU CUET Subject Mapping
B.Sc. (Hons.) B.Sc. (Hons.) Anthropology Physics, Chemistry,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Biological Sciences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biological Studies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Botany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biological Studies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Zoology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biological Studies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Biomedical Science Physics, Chemistry,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Biochemistry Physics, Chemistry,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ry/Mathematics/Applied Mathematics,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Chemistry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Physics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Polymer Science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Computer Science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II
B.Sc. (Hons.) Electronics Physics, Chemistry/ Computer Science/Informatics Practices,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Instrumentation Physics, Chemistry/ Computer Science/Informatics Practices,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ons) Environmental Science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ics/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Food Technology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ics/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Geology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ics/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ry/ Geography,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Mathematics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II
B.Sc. (Hons.) Statistics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II
B.Sc. (Hons.) Home Science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Physics/ Chemistry, Any one from Section II,Any one Language
B.Sc. (Hons.) Microbiology Physics, Chemistry,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
Bachelors B.Tech. (Information Technology and Mathematical Innovation) Any one from Section I +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Section III
B.Sc. (Pass) B.Sc. (Prog.) Applied Physical Sciences with Analytical Methods in Chemistry and Biochemistry Physcics,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, Chem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Prog.) Physical Science with Computer Science/ Informatics Practices Physics+Mathematics/Applied Mathematics+Chemistry/ Computer Science/Informatics Practices,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Prog.) Applied Physical Sciences with Industrial Chemistry Physcics+Mathematics/Applied Mathematics+Chemistry, Any one Language
B. Sc. (Prog.) Physical Science with Electronics Physcics+Mathematics/Applied Mathematics+Chemistry/ Computer Science/Informatics Practices,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Prog.) Life Science Physics+Chemsitry+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Prog.) Applied Life Science Physics+Chemsitry+ Biology/BiologicalStudies/Biotechnology/Biochem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Pass) Home Science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
B. Sc. (Prog.) Physical Science with Chemistry Physics+Mathematics/Applied Mathematics+Chemistry, Any one Language
B.Sc. (Prog.) Mathematical Science Any one from Section I +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II
B.Sc. B.Sc. in Physical Education, Health Education & Sports "Any one from Section I +Physical Education / National Cadet Corps (NCC) / Yoga + Any two from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II"

DU CUET Subject Combination: Commerce Courses

Check the list of 07 UG Commerce courses by University of Delhi through CUET scores

Degree DU CUET UG Courses Offered DU CUET Subject Mapping
B. Com (Hons.) B. Com. (Hons.)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ics/ Accountancy/Book Keeping + Any two from Section II
B. Com. B. Com.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
Bachelor of Management Studies [BMS] Bachelor of Management Studies [BMS]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Section III
Bachelor of Business Administration (Financial Investment Analysis) [BBA(FIA)] Bachelor of Business Administration (Financial Investment Analysis) [BBA(FIA)]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Section III
Bachelor of Business Economics [BBE] Bachelor of Business Economics [BBE]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Section III

DU CUET Subject Combination: Arts Courses

Check the list of 41 UG Arts courses by University of Delhi through CUET scores

Degree DU CUET UG Courses Offered DU CUET Subject Combinations
B.A. (Hons.) B.A.(Hons.) Punjabi Punjabi + Any three from Section II OR any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ons) Persian Persian + Any three from Section II OR any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) French French + Any three from Section II OR any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) German German + Any three from Section II OR any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Philosophy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Journalism English + any three from Section II / Section III
B.A. Hons. (Humanities and Social Sciences) (offered by Cluster Innovation Centre) Any one from Section I + any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Political Science Any one from Section I + any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Social Work Any one from Section I + any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Sociology Any one from Section I + any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Multi-Media and Mass Communication Any one from Section I + any one from Section II+ Section III
B.A. (Program) B.A. (Program)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
B.Voc. B.Voc. (Health Care Management)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
B.Voc. B.Voc. (Web Designing)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II ORAny one from Section I+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Section III
B.A. (Hons.) B.A. (Hons.) Sanskrit Any one from Section I + Sanskrit from Section I/ Section II + Any two from Section II OR Sanskrit from Section I+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) English English+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Italian Italian +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Applied Psychology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ons) Hindi Patrakarita Hindi + Any three from Section II / Section III
B.A.(Hons.) History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
Degree Five Year Integrated Program in Journalism English/ Hindi + Section III
B.Voc. B.Voc. (Banking Operations)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
B.Voc. B.Voc. (Software Development)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Mathematics/Applied Mathematics+ Section III
B.A. (Hons.) B.A. (Hons) Hindi Hindi +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Bengali Bengali +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Urdu Urdu +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Arabic Arabic +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ons.) Spanish Spanish +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Psychology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Geography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A.(Hons.) Economics Any one from Section I + Mathematics/Applied Mathematics + Any two from Section II
B.A. B.A. (Vocational Studies)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
B.Voc. B.Voc. (Retail Management and IT)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II OR Any one from Section I+ Any one from Section II + Section III
B.A. (Hons) B.A. (Hons) in Karnatak Music- Vocal/ Instrumental (Veena/ Violin) Any one from Section I Performing Arts + Any two from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ons) in Hindustani Music- Vocal/ Instrumental (Sitar/ Sarod/ Guitar/ Violin/ Santoor Any one from Section I Performing Arts + Any two from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
Bachelor of Elementary Education (B.El.Ed.) Bachelor of Elementary Education (B.El.Ed.) Any one from Section I + any three from Section II
B.A. (Hons) B.A. (Hons) in Hindustani Music – Percussion (Tabla/ Pakhawaj) Any one from Section I Performing Arts + Any two from Section II OR Any one from Section I + Any three from Section II
Bachelor of Fine Arts Bachelor of Fine Arts (BFA) Any one from Section I + Any Section III
B.A. (Hons.) B.A. (Hons.) Russian Russian + Any three from Section II OR any one from Section I + any three from Section II

How to Select DU CUET Subject Combination?

While filling the CUET 2026 application form, candidates must enter the CUET subject combination as per the DU courses eligibility mentioned above. Candidates will be able to choose a maximum of 05 subjects for CUET, which includes 03 or 04 domain subjects, including General Test and 01 or 02 languages.  While selecting DU CUET subjects, candidates must note the important strategies below:

  1. Candidates must align the CUET subjects with the subjects studied in class 12th. It is an important criteria for DU admissions.
  2. Candidates must choose the subjects they are good at. Picking which interests the candidate can boost chances of doing well in the exam.
  3. Candidates must consider what they want to study in college and what career they are interested in. For example, candidate wants to study physics he/she must map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ics/Applied Mathematics, and any one of CUET subjects.
